Philippe Lemay (Trois-Rivieres, PQ) lost 8-6 to Simon Dupuis (Buckingham, PQ) in the Final of the Vic Open, held December 13 - 16, 2012 at the Victoria Curling Club in Quebec, Canada. To advance to the championship game, Lemay won 8-7 over Michael Fournier (Montreal, PQ) in the semifinals of the 2012 Vic Open in Quebec, Quebec, Canada; and won 6-1 over Denis Laflamme (Sept-Iles, PQ) in the quarterfinals. of the 2012 Vic Open in Quebec, Quebec, Canada;
Lemay finished 3-0 in the 16-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Lemay defeated Pascal Chouinard (Quebec, PQ) 8-7, then won 8-3 against Nicolas Marceau (Quebec, PQ) and 7-4 against Steeve Gagnon (Rosemere, PQ) in their final qualifying round match.
With their runner-up finish at the Vic Open, Lemay take home 2.625 world rankings points along with the $1,700CDN prize, moving up 6 spots the World Ranking Standings into 81st place overall with 20.465 total points. Lemay ranks 122nd overall on the Year-to-Date rankings with 4.875 points earned so far this season.
